2 A 2-point response provides two text-based details to explain why health care in rural Kentucky improved after Mary established the Frontier Nursing Service.

Example:Health care in rural Kentucky improved a great deal after Mary set up the Frontier Nursing Service because she built clinics and a small hospital, and she provided care the mountain folk hadn’t been able to afford before.

1 A 1-point response provides one text-based detail to explain why health care in rural Kentucky improved after Mary established the Frontier Nursing Service.
